IQQW.DE vs. XG12.DE
IQQW.DE (iShares MSCI World UCITS ETF USD (Dist)) and XG12.DE (Xtrackers MSCI Global SDG 12 Circular Economy UCITS ETF 1C) are both Global Equities funds - IQQW.DE tracks the MSCI World Index while XG12.DE tracks the MSCI ACWI IMI SDG 12 Responsible Consumption and Production Select. Both are passively managed. Over the past 3 years, IQQW.DE returned 17.17%/yr vs 10.96%/yr for XG12.DE. A 0.73 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. IQQW.DE charges 0.50%/yr vs 0.35%/yr for XG12.DE.
